Standard Tax Difficulties You Could Deal With

Taxpayers frequently face a variety of common tax problems that can complicate their money matters. One frequent problem is underreporting income, which can lead to surprising tax obligations and penalties. Additionally, many people struggle with wrong tax deductions, claiming costs that do not qualify, thereby increasing their tax load.

Filing errors are another prevalent issue, spanning simple mistakes on tax forms to overlooked deadlines. These errors can result in delays in handling refunds or, worse, audits from the IRS. Taxpayers may also encounter difficulties concerning changes in tax laws, which can create confusion about adherence and eligibility for certain credits.

In addition, various people experience complications with unpaid taxes, resulting in compounding interest and penalties. Knowing about these prevalent tax complications is essential for taxpayers in navigating their financial commitments and preventing difficulties with the IRS.

Tax Debt Discussion Techniques

Dealing with tax debt can be daunting, but skilled negotiation tactics utilized by an IRS tax attorney can greatly ease the burden. These experts evaluate an person's financial circumstances and explore options such as settlement offers, which allow taxpayers to settle their debt for less than owed. They can also arrange installment agreements, enabling manageable payment plans over time. By utilizing their knowledge of tax regulations and IRS procedures, attorneys can advocate for lower penalties and interest, ensuring a fair resolution. Additionally, they may facilitate communication between the taxpayer and the IRS, decreasing stress and miscommunication. Ultimately, employing a skilled tax attorney improves the chances of achieving a positive result in tax debt negotiations.

Documentation and Evidence Collection

When the tax resolution procedure begins, the collection of documentation and evidence is vital for developing a robust case. Tax attorneys commence by gathering applicable financial documents, including tax returns, bank statements, and correspondence with the IRS. This documentation helps to establish the taxpayer's financial situation and any differences that may exist.

Additionally, documentation such as proof of expenses, financial records, and previous audits is collected to substantiate any assertions made during the dispute resolution. The legal representative carefully arranges this information to ensure clarity and easy access. A thorough collection of documentation not only helps clarify the case but also strengthens the taxpayer's position, enabling productive dialogue with tax authorities throughout the resolution process.

Negotiation and Settlement Strategies

Armed with a robust collection of documentation, tax attorneys can now focus on negotiation and settlement strategies. This stage involves evaluating the financial condition of the taxpayer to formulate a persuasive case for the IRS. Tax attorneys often pursue compromise offers, which allow taxpayers to settle their debts for below the total amount due. They may also seek installment agreements to ease financial obligations over time. Additionally, attorneys can advocate for penalty reduction, contending for waiver of specific penalties based on justifiable reasons. Throughout this procedure, strong communication and skilled negotiation strategies are essential, as tax attorneys aim to achieve the most favorable resolution for their clients, ultimately reducing financial stress and ensuring compliance with tax obligations.

What Is the Average Cost of Hiring an IRS Tax Attorney?

Hiring an IRS tax lawyer generally costs between $200 and $500 per hour, depending on the lawyer's expertise and the intricacy of the case. Fixed rates for specific services may also be available.

Is It Possible to speak for Myself in IRS Meetings?

Yes, people can represent themselves in IRS hearings. However, maneuvering through complex tax laws and procedures may result in difficulties, making expert attorney assistance typically recommended to guarantee a more favorable outcome and prevent possible mistakes.

What Background Should I Search for in a Tax Advisor?

When looking to hire a tax attorney, one should assess their expertise in tax law, relevant qualifications, track record in comparable situations, communication abilities, and understanding of IRS requirements to guarantee strong representation and direction.

How lengthy Is the Tax Resolution Process typically?

Tax settlement generally varies in duration, ranging from a few months to over a year, contingent upon case complexity, how responsive the taxpayer is, and the particular IRS processes involved.

Can Retaining a Tax Counsel Guarantee a Favorable Conclusion?

Securing a tax specialist does not ensure a favorable outcome. Their experience can elevate chances, but outcomes are contingent on various factors, covering the difficulty level of the case, quality of documentation, and cooperation with tax authorities.
